damn, I had implicitly assumed signed characters when writing the
rolling checksum code. The result is that rsync worked much more slowly when going between two machines where one of the machines uses signed and the other unsigned chars. The rolling checksum rarely matched so effectively a copy was done in many cases. The data always came through correctly so no file corruption occurred but it's pretty pointless using rsync if it doesn't speed things up! I've now made the sign of the chars explicit
